Late Palaeolithic and Epi-Palaeolithic North Africa

The Late Palaeolithic and Epi-Palaeolithic of North Africa describe a long, regionally varied phase of human adaptation spanning the final Pleistocene and early Holocene. Archaeological evidence includes blade and bladelet industries, Levallois traditions, bone tools, burial practices, personal ornamentation, and changing exploitation of plant, animal, riverine, and lake resources. The period is marked by uneven technological transformation, strong regional diversity, and unresolved relationships between indigenous development and external diffusion. The evidence does not support a single simple evolutionary or cultural trajectory across the Maghrib, Cyrenaica, the Nile Valley, Nubia, and the Sahara.

A mosaic of late prehistoric traditions

Late Palaeolithic and Epi-Palaeolithic North Africa was not characterized by a single, continent-wide sequence of technological change. The Dabban Industry appeared in Cyrenaica before 30,000 BC and seems to have persisted as an enclave alongside traditions rooted in Middle Palaeolithic Levallois methods. In the Nile Valley, Levallois working survived until the end of the Pleistocene, while blade and bladelet industries became prominent only later. The resulting archaeological pattern was uneven, regional, and resistant to a simple division between old and new traditions.

After about 20,000 BC, artifact assemblages became more regionally differentiated across North Africa. This diversity may reflect higher population densities and more specialized adaptations to distinct ecological zones, producing what the passage describes as industrial mosaics. The Nile Valley, Nubia, Cyrenaica, the Maghrib, and the Sahara each developed localized combinations of techniques and artifacts. Similarities between these regions may indicate movement and contact, but they could also result from gradual transformation or adaptation across broad environmental settings.

Human skeletal evidence is sparse and unevenly distributed. After about 12,000 BC, remains cluster especially in the central and western Maghrib and in Nubia. Iberomaurusian skeletons are commonly associated with the robust Mechta–Afalou type, whereas Capsian populations tended to be more gracile, although the two forms sometimes overlapped. The origins of these populations remain unresolved: proposed explanations include local evolution from archaic North African populations, movements from southwestern Asia, and wider African contributions. The absence of securely dated remains from key industrial contexts prevents a confident reconstruction.

Technology, subsistence, and symbolic practice

The period saw several possible technological specializations, including punched-blade production, greater emphasis on blades and bladelets, and wider use of bone tools in some regions. Composite implements combining stone and organic materials may have improved hunting, food processing, and artifact manufacture, although their precise advantages cannot always be demonstrated. The evidence does not establish whether bows, spear-throwers, nets, boats, or other major energy-capture technologies were introduced during this period. Permanent settlement and durable architecture also remain poorly documented.

Subsistence appears to have become more intensive in parts of North Africa during the final Pleistocene and early Holocene. Plant foods may have received greater attention, while the Sahara and Nile Valley show indications of increased fishing, perhaps in response to environmental deterioration. River and lake settings could support larger communities and greater sedentarism. These developments may represent an intensification of broad-spectrum subsistence, though the precise timing, causes, and regional extent remain uncertain.

Symbolic behavior included engravings, paintings, personal decoration, ochre use, grave goods, tooth evulsion, and skeletal modification, but these practices were distributed unevenly. Burial customs were especially common in the Maghrib and much less evident in the Nile Valley and perhaps Cyrenaica. Figurative and decorative art also appears more prominent in the Epi-Palaeolithic of the Maghrib and Sahara than elsewhere in the region. The functions and meanings of the art cannot be securely established and may have included ritual, commemorative, social, and individual purposes.

Diffusion and indigenous development

The passage finds no good evidence that North African blade-tool industries developed directly from local Middle Palaeolithic or Mousterian traditions. The Dabban Industry and the earliest modern humans may instead reflect diffusion from outside the region, possibly involving southwestern Asia, although the evidence is insufficient to identify routes or movements with confidence. Later blade and microlithic industries in the Nile Valley may have had connections with Palestine, but the Levantine sequence is considered too poorly known and dated for firm conclusions.

At the same time, an exclusively external explanation is also inadequate. The proposed indigenous evolution of the Mechta–Afalou type from hypothetical North African Neanderthal populations lacks direct skeletal support, because remains are absent from several relevant industrial contexts. Earlier archaic Homo sapiens populations in the Omo basin and the Lake Victoria region demonstrate that other African regions must be considered in discussions of human development. The history of North African populations therefore cannot be treated as an isolated process or reduced to a single direction of migration.

By the early Holocene, changes toward less rugged physical forms may have resulted from several interacting processes, including mutation, genetic drift, selection in hot and dry environments, altered marriage and residence patterns, and migration. The archaeological record likewise reflects interactions among technology, subsistence, population density, mobility, and social differentiation. More efficient exploitation of local resources may have reduced the territories over which groups moved, encouraging localized artifact styles and stronger regional identities. The overall pattern is one of cultural diversity and discontinuity whose mechanisms remain open to further research.
